Driveway. But I do park mon-fri at my job in a garage which keeps her in great condition since its the daytime elements like harsh sun, bird crap etc. that messes up your paint.

Since it is parked outside and I'm king **** about my ride. It gets washed once a week regardless rain or shine and it also gets a waxing every 6 weeks and a clay/high-speed buff once a year.

It looks garage kept.
